WRIGHTS CORNERS — A 54-year-old Town of Lockport woman was charged with aggravated DWI for having a blood alcohol content of two and a half times the legal limit, according to the Niagara County Sheriff's Office.

Cindy S. Wolcott, 54, 4333 Plank Road was seen driving on the shoulder of the road around 4:38 p.m. Friday, according to her arrest report. The vehicle then crossed the double yellow line for no apparent reason before patrol initiated a traffic stop.

"Patrol asked the driver to produce her license and registration," the arrest report said. "She handed patrol a framed picture of her family."

Wolcott reportedly asked patrol, "Can't you just drive me home? I know I had too much too drink."

She was determined to be intoxicated and found to have a blood alcohol content of .21 percent.

She was charged with DWI, aggravated DWI, failure to keep right and driving on the shoulder. She was taken to Niagara County Jail and held on $250 bail. She is scheduled to appear in Town of Newfane Court on Jan. 6.
